Monthly estimate = 1BR rent + electricity + gas

A one-person monthly baseline (1BR rent plus typical utilities) runs $1,030 in Billings, MT versus $1,030 in Cincinnati, OH. The two are close overall, within a few percent of each other.

Median household income is $71,855 in Billings, MT and $51,707 in Cincinnati, OH — about 28% higher in Billings, MT. Montana has a top state income tax rate of 5.65% and no state sales tax; Ohio has a top state income tax rate of 2.75% and a 5.75% state sales tax.

Billings vs Cincinnati — FAQ

Is it cheaper to live in Billings or Cincinnati?
They're close. Billings, MT runs about $1,030 a month and Cincinnati, OH about $1,030 (1BR rent + utilities) — within a few percent of each other.
How much more do you need to earn to live in Billings than in Cincinnati?
To keep rent near the recommended 30% of gross income, you'd want to earn roughly $36,000 a year in Billings versus $33,000 in Cincinnati.
Which has lower taxes, Billings or Cincinnati?
Billings is taxed under Montana's rules (a top state income tax rate of 5.65% and no state sales tax); Cincinnati under Ohio's (a top state income tax rate of 2.75% and a 5.75% state sales tax).
